Chocolate Mint Bars

INGREDIENTS

1/2 c Shortening
2/3 Granulated Sugar
1/4 c American-process Cocoa
1 Whole Egg
1 1/4 c All-purpose Flour
1 1/2 c Flaked Coconut
1 c Sliced Almonds
3/4 c Mint Chips
1 Sweetened Condensed Milk
1/2 t Peppermint Extract

INSTRUCTIONS

Pre-heat oven to 350-F degrees and set aside a 9-inch by 13-inch cake
pan.  In a large mixing bowl, cream together the shortening, sugar,
cocoa,  and egg until smooth. Sift in the flour and mix until well
blended.  Press the mixture firmly into the bottom of the cake pan.
Bake for  about  To prepare the topping, combine the coconut, almonds,
and mint chips  in a bowl, then sprinkle over the baked chocolate base.
In a separate mixing bowl, combine the sweetened condensed milk and
peppermint extract. Pour the mixture evenly over the top of the nuts
and coconut.  Bake for 20 to 25 minutes, or until golden. Cool, then
